机构地区:[1]广东医学院病理生理学教研室,广东医学院生物化学教研室,深圳三九企业集团医药研究所
出 处:《广东医学院学报》1994年第4期291-294,共4页Journal of Guangdong Medical College
摘 要:以人早幼粒白血病细胞系HL-60为对象,进行了MTT法细胞浓度曲线和五种抗癌药物的敏感试验,并与台盼蓝拒染法、 ̄3H-TdR掺入法进行了比较,结果表明在一定活细胞范围内(1.25×10 ̄4~2×10 ̄5),MTT法所测光密度与细胞数成线性关系(r=0.9980,P<0.05);三种方法测定的5-Fu、MTX、VCR、H、Ara-C药物敏感性结果一致,MTT法灵敏度与台盼蓝拒染法相似(P>0.05),但低于 ̄3H-TdR掺入法(P<0.05)。The MTT assay was used to run the cell concetration curve test and assess the sensitivity of human promyelocytic leukemia HL-60 cells to five chemotherapeutic agents, and compared with the trypan blue exclusion and 3H-TdR incorporation assay The results showed that there was a linear relationship between the viable cell number and the optical density of the MTT formazan product, when the viable cell number was in the range of 1.25×104~2×105.The result of chemosensitivity testing of three kinds of assays was consistent with 5-Fu、MTX、VCR、H、Ara-C. The sensitivity of the MTT assay was similar to that of the trypan blue exclusion assay (P>0.05)but lower than that of the 3H-TdR incoporation assay(P<0.05)
